迟播条件下温度特征与小麦产量及品质的关系
Relationships Between Temperature Characteristics and Wheat Yield,and Quality under Delayed Sowing Conditions
摘要
Abstract
To investigate the effects of delayed sowing on the growth,development,grain yield and quality of wheat,Yunong 907(YN907)and Yunong 922(YN922),two new high yield and high quality wheat varieties,were selected as experimental materials.Three sowing dates were established:October 22nd(S1,the conventional sowing date),October 31 st(S2,delayed sowing by 9 days),and November 9th(S3,delayed sowing by 18 days).The study investigated the effects of delayed sowing on the phenological stages,grain yield and flour quality of wheat,and analyzed the relationship between temperature characteristics and wheat yield,and quality under de-layed sowing conditions.The results indicated that compared with the conventional sowing date,the full growth period of YN907 and YN922 was shortened with the delay of sowing date in both years.The accumulated temper-ature before winter and the average daily temperature before heading decreased with the delay of sowing date,while the average daily temperature and effective accumulated temperature after heading increased.The effective accumulated temperature of the full growth period showed a downward trend.The effective accumulated temperature of the full growth period of YN907 and YN922 in S3 treatment was 243.95,222.10℃·d lower than that in S1 treat-ment in 2022-2023,and 136.30,189.40 ℃·d lower in 2023-2024,respectively.The yield and its components decreased with the delay of sowing,with a yield reduction of 6.45%to 17.26%.Compared with the conventional sowing date,the wet gluten content and protein content increased under the delayed sowing conditions.Under the background of climate warming and the scale-up of the agricultural operation,the sowing date of wheat can be adjus-ted to adapt to the temperature change.YN907 and YN922 had the highest yield on October 22nd.Delaying the so-wing date to October 31st could maintain the higher yield level and increase the grain protein content.When the so-wing date continues to be postponed,the grain protein content will be significantly increased but the yield will be significantly decreased.关键词
